Bato asks supporters: Grant Digong’s wish, vote straight for PDP-Laban

Alvin Murcia

Reelectionist Senator Ronald “Bato” Dela Rosa is appealing to the supporters of former President Rodrigo Duterte to grant his wish and vote straight for PDP-Laban senatorial candidates.

“Lahat ng partido gustong i-dominate ang resulta. So si Pangulong Duterte, bilang chairman ng PDP Laban, ay siya po ay nagnanais at nangangarap na maraming PDP Laban candidates ang mananalo dito sa halalan ng midterm elections,” Dela Rosa said in a radio interview.

“So lahat po tayo ay nangangarap. Sana po ay ‘yung kanyang panawagan ay pakinggan ng ating mga kababayan para naman po maraming PDP Laban ang makapasok,” the Mindanaoan lawmaker added.

Giving an update after the former president’s birthday, Vice President Sara Duterte said his father wants the supporters to stop discussing the legal aspects of his International Criminal Court case and if they want to show their support, they should vote for the PDP-Laban candidates and guest candidates in the 12 May polls.

“Sinabi niya, hindi na niya magawa ang mangampanya, tumayo sa stage doon sa Pilipinas…kaya sabi niya, ipaabot sa inyo na kailangan niya ang tulong. Kailangan niya ang mga PDP Senators at mga guest candidates ng PDP-Laban,” the vice president said.

Last 20 March, the vice president also personally asked the public to vote for the nine senatorial candidates endorsed by the PDP-Laban, saying they will change the face of the government.

The PDP-Laban senatorial line-up includes Dela Rosa, Senator Bong Go, Atty. Jimmy Bondoc, Atty. Jayvee Hinlo, Atty. Raul Lambino, Philip Salvador, Rep. Dante Marcoleta, Pastor Apollo Quiboloy, and Atty. Vic Rodriguez.
